Miss Islington (bot)
f4b8cd5510
[3.13] ast docs: Fix description of ast.Constant (GH-134741) (#134912)
Contrary to the current docs, ast.Constant will never hold containers
such as frozenset or tuple; the Python parser only emits it for simple
literals.

For precision, add the exact list of types that may be contained in an
ast.Constant.

bc60b33745
[3.13] gh-132246: Add special buffer methods to C API Type Object docs (gh-132247) (gh-134427)
Two special methods, __buffer__ and __release_buffer__ were added to
Python 3.12 by PEP 688. The C API Type Object documentation for slots
includes `tp_as_buffer`, and sub-slots `bf_getbuffer`, `bf_releasebuffer`
but does not refer to the Python Data Model version of those. Add the
missing references.
